свертка базы

  • Автор темы olga0389
  • Дата начала
O

olga0389

Гость
#1
здравствуйте!
мне нужно базу Управление торговлей 8.2 обрезать до 2011г. Обработка по свертки базы помечает документы на удаление,но при самом удалении очень много документов не удаляются из за того что есть ссылка на них,но все что привязано к ним создано до 2011 года,помогите советом как правильно обезать базу?
 

Дайнеко

Well-Known Member
19.11.2009
951
0
#2
Я так и оставляю старые документы. Только:
- снимаю пометку удаления
- утилитой удаляю в них строки, чтобы они не держали старые товары.
- можно и удалить в них ссылку на клиентов.
 
O

olga0389

Гость
#3
так там очень много документов остается,больше чем удалилось
 

Дайнеко

Well-Known Member
19.11.2009
951
0
#4
Так кузькину мать! Почему они не удаляются? А ну ка подробненько изложите на что они ссылаются. Глядишь, и сами догадаетесь.
Например, у меня в программе, Приходные прописаны в партиях товаров (не знаю что в типовой). Естественно, тогда я удаляю и партии - удалятся те, где нулевой остаток, с ними и Приходные.
А строки удаляю в неудаляемых Приходных, т.к. часть строк ссылается на товар, который может удалиться. При неочищеном документе они не удалятся.
 
O

olga0389

Гость
#5
подробнее не смогу,на работе база осталась,просто если в ручную обрабаотывать документы не удобно,их уж очень много.
а ссылаются доки видела на другие документы,которые в принципе тоже должны удалиться..
делала свертку бухгалтерии,так там без проблем все прошло..
 

Дайнеко

Well-Known Member
19.11.2009
951
0
#6
Да, база это свернутый клубок. Но в нем есть исходные объекты, остальные зависят от них по цепочке.
Вручную ничего обработать не реально, только утилитами.

Работайте.
 

Дайнеко

Well-Known Member
19.11.2009
951
0
#8
На диске ИТС есть обработки "ПоискИЗаменаЗначений", "УниверсальныеПодборИОбработкаОбъектов". Они помогт очистить ссылки на удаляемые объекты.